Output 17d6ddb4d596b89e4b4ce1215fe340ed0415e0ab7a666b3987ae1b0ed062b126:9

value
285119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3f85f1e5289ac0f65721a2ec34bfeb96e968687 OP_EQUAL
address
3Pw1fKL42nDNY6KuzEpSFp7HUAtyKdGLLK
transaction
17d6ddb4d596b89e4b4ce1215fe340ed0415e0ab7a666b3987ae1b0ed062b126
spent
true